Pagini recente » Cod sursa (job #2447165) | Cod sursa (job #2781117) | Cod sursa (job #997665) | Cod sursa (job #532201) | Cod sursa (job #898888)
Cod sursa(job #898888)
#include<stdio.h>
using namespace std;
//ifstream f("text.in");
//ofstream g("text.in");
FILE *f=fopen("text.in","r"), *g=fopen("text.out","w");
char x,y;
int nrcuv,nrlitere;
int main(){
fscanf(f,"%c",&y);
while(fscanf(f,"%c",&x)!= EOF ){ //if(x == '-' || x == ',' || x == '.' || x == ' ' || x == '!' || x == '?' || x == ';' || x == ':' || x == '\n'){
if(!(x>='a' && x<='z' || x>='0' && x<='9' || x>='A' && x<='Z')){
if(y>='a' && y<='z' || y>='0' && y<='9' || y>='A' && y<='Z')
nrcuv++;
}
else
nrlitere++;
y=x;
}
fprintf(g,"%d", nrlitere/nrcuv);
return 0;
}